X-Git-Url: http://git.pld-linux.org/?p=packages%2Frpm.git;a=blobdiff_plain;f=rpm.spec;h=f307ceb10e03377b1a51f292303956e31b2ddd07;hp=8fb89483b04b4a5fb584c64ab38fd3f502d53295;hb=1424412b4ec2eccf1615845fd01211c2a4303ee3;hpb=f09b01ac0416d9ed4a94b16f8df770b979fb75e3 diff --git a/rpm.spec b/rpm.spec index 8fb8948..f307ceb 100644 --- a/rpm.spec +++ b/rpm.spec @@ -52,7 +52,7 @@ Summary(ru.UTF-8): Менеджер пакетов от RPM Summary(uk.UTF-8): Менеджер пакетів від RPM Name: rpm Version: 5.4.10 -Release: 44 +Release: 47 License: LGPL Group: Base # http://rpm5.org/files/rpm/rpm-5.4/rpm-5.4.10-0.20120706.src.rpm @@ -94,6 +94,7 @@ Source29: dbupgrade.sh Patch0: %{name}-branch.patch Patch1: %{name}-man_pl.patch Patch2: %{name}-popt-aliases.patch +Patch3: %{name}-nosetproctitle.patch Patch4: %{name}-perl-macros.patch Patch5: %{name}-perl-req-perlfile.patch Patch6: %{name}-scripts-closefds.patch @@ -157,6 +158,7 @@ Patch63: %{name}-pythoneggs.patch Patch64: %{name}-fix-compress-doc.patch Patch65: %{name}-parseSpec-skip-empty-tags.patch Patch66: %{name}-payload-use-hashed-inode.patch +Patch67: rpm-repackage-dont-force-max-compression.patch # Patches imported from Mandriva @@ -620,7 +622,7 @@ Summary(ru.UTF-8): Скрипты и утилиты, необходимые дл Summary(uk.UTF-8): Скрипти та утиліти, необхідні для побудови пакетів Group: Applications/File Requires(pre): findutils -Requires: %{name}-build-macros >= 1.653 +Requires: %{name}-build-macros >= 1.656 Requires: %{name}-utils = %{version}-%{release} Requires: /bin/id Requires: awk @@ -812,6 +814,7 @@ Dokumentacja API RPM-a oraz przewodniki w formacie HTML generowane ze #patch0 -p1 %patch1 -p1 %patch2 -p1 +%patch3 -p1 %patch4 -p1 %patch5 -p1 %patch6 -p1 @@ -880,6 +883,7 @@ Dokumentacja API RPM-a oraz przewodniki w formacie HTML generowane ze %patch64 -p1 %patch65 -p1 %patch66 -p1 +%patch67 -p1 %patch1000 -p1 %patch1001 -p1 @@ -1135,6 +1139,13 @@ rm $RPM_BUILD_ROOT%{_rpmlibdir}/vpkg-provides* rm $RPM_BUILD_ROOT%{_rpmlibdir}/find-{prov,req}.pl rm $RPM_BUILD_ROOT%{_rpmlibdir}/find-{provides,requires}.perl rm $RPM_BUILD_ROOT%{_rpmlibdir}/find-lang.sh +rm $RPM_BUILD_ROOT%{_rpmlibdir}/macros.d/ruby +rm $RPM_BUILD_ROOT%{_rpmlibdir}/lib/liblua.a +rm $RPM_BUILD_ROOT%{_rpmlibdir}/lib/liblua.la +rm $RPM_BUILD_ROOT%{_rpmlibdir}/mono-find-provides +rm $RPM_BUILD_ROOT%{_rpmlibdir}/mono-find-requires + +%{__sed} -i -e '/macros.d\/ruby/ s/^/#/' $RPM_BUILD_ROOT%{_rpmlibdir}/macros # not installed since 4.4.8 (-tools-perl subpackage) install scripts/rpmdiff scripts/rpmdiff.cgi $RPM_BUILD_ROOT%{_rpmlibdir} @@ -1469,7 +1480,6 @@ find %{_rpmlibdir} -name '*-linux' -type l | xargs rm -f %{_rpmlibdir}/macros.d/php %{_rpmlibdir}/macros.d/pkgconfig %{_rpmlibdir}/macros.d/python -%{_rpmlibdir}/macros.d/ruby %{_rpmlibdir}/macros.d/selinux %{_rpmlibdir}/macros.d/tcl %{_rpmlibdir}/macros.rpmbuild